    A student moves a box of books down the hall by pulling on a rope
    A student moves a box of books down the hall
    By pulling on a rope attached to the box. The
    Student pulls with a force of 179 N at an angle
    Of 31.0

    Above the horizontal. The box has a
    Mass of 37.4 kg, and µk between the box and
    The floor is 0.23.
    The acceleration of gravity is 9.81 m/s
    2
    .
    Find the acceleration of the box.
    Answer in units of m/s

    Find the reaction force of the floor on the box by using the vertical component of the force coming from the rope. Using that force, find the frictional force.

    Then find the horizontal component of the force coming from the rope and find the net force from this force and the frictional force.

    Finally, use F = ma to get the acceleration of the box.
